Bdk Flutter #























A Flutter library for the Bitcoin Development Kit.
The bdk library aims to be the core building block for Bitcoin Applications of any kind.
Requirements #

Flutter : 3.0 or higher
Android minSdkVersion. : API 23 or higher.
Deployment target : iOS 12.0 or greater.

How to Use #
To use the bdk_flutter package in your project, add it as a dependency in your project's pubspec.yaml:
dependencies:
bdk_flutter: ^0.30.0

Examples #
Create a Wallet & sync the balance of a descriptor #
import 'package:bdk_flutter/bdk_flutter.dart';

// ....

final mnemonic = await Mnemonic.create(WordCount.Words12);
final descriptorSecretKey = await DescriptorSecretKey.create( network: Network.Testnet,
mnemonic: mnemonic );
final externalDescriptor = await Descriptor.newBip44( descriptorSecretKey: descriptorSecretKey,
network: Network.Testnet,
keychain: KeyChainKind.External );
final internalDescriptor = await Descriptor.newBip44( descriptorSecretKey: descriptorSecretKey,
network: Network.Testnet,
keychain: KeyChainKind.Internal );
final blockchain = await Blockchain.create( config: BlockchainConfig.electrum(
config: ElectrumConfig(
stopGap: 10,
timeout: 5,
retry: 5,
url: "ssl://electrum.blockstream.info:60002" )));
final wallet = await Wallet.create( descriptor: externalDescriptor,
changeDescriptor: internalDescriptor,
network: Network.TESTNET,
databaseConfig: const DatabaseConfig.memory() );
final _ = await wallet.sync( blockchain );

Create a public wallet descriptor #
import 'package:bdk_flutter/bdk_flutter.dart';

// ....

final mnemonic = await Mnemonic.create(WordCount.Words12);
final descriptorSecretKey = await DescriptorSecretKey.create( network: Network.Testnet,
mnemonic: mnemonic );
final externalDescriptor = await Descriptor.newBip44( descriptorSecretKey: descriptorSecretKey,
network: Network.Testnet,
keychain: KeyChainKind.External );
final externalPublicDescriptorStr = await externalDescriptor.asString();
final externalPublicDescriptor = await Descriptor.( descriptor: externalPublicDescriptorStr,
network: Network.Testnet);

Create an internal and extarnal wallet descriptors from derivation path. #
import 'package:bdk_flutter/bdk_flutter.dart';


final mnemonic = await Mnemonic.create(WordCount.Words12);
final descriptorSecretKey = await DescriptorSecretKey.create(
network: Network.Testnet, mnemonic: mnemonic);

// create external descriptor
final derivationPath = await DerivationPath.create(path: "m/44h/1h/0h/0");
final descriptorPrivateKey =
await descriptorSecretKey.derive(derivationPath);
final Descriptor descriptorPrivate = await Descriptor.create(
descriptor: "pkh(${descriptorPrivateKey.toString()})",
network: Network.Testnet,
);

// create internal descriptor
final derivationPathInt =
await DerivationPath.create(path: "m/44h/1h/0h/1");
final descriptorPrivateKeyInt =
await descriptorSecretKey.derive(derivationPathInt);
final Descriptor descriptorPrivateInt = await Descriptor.create(
descriptor: "pkh(${descriptorPrivateKeyInt.toString()})",
network: Network.Testnet,
);

final bdkWallet = await Wallet.create(
descriptor: descriptorPrivate,
changeDescriptor: descriptorPrivateInt,
network: Network.Testnet,
databaseConfig: const DatabaseConfig.memory(),
);

final address =
await bdkWallet.getAddress(addressIndex: const AddressIndex());
final internalAddress =
await bdkWallet.getInternalAddress(addressIndex: const AddressIndex());

How to build #
Note that Flutter version 3.0 or later is required to build the plugin.


Install Rust and Cargo
The easiest way to get Cargo is to install the current stable release of Rust by using rustup. Installing Rust using rustup will also install cargo.


Clone this repository
git clone https://github.com/LtbLightning/bdk-flutter
copied to clipboard


Activate dart ffigen
dart pub global activate ffigen
copied to clipboard


Android Setup




The Android NDK, or Native Development Kit, enables code written in other languages to be run on the JVM via the Java Native Interface, or JNI for short.
After following the instructions above, the NDK should be installed in your $ANDROID_SDK_HOME/ndk folder, where ANDROID_SDK_HOME usually is:
Windows: %APPDATA%\Local\Android\sdk
MacOS: ~/Library/Android/sdk
An issue regarding building Rust's core library against the latest NDK means that as of writing only NDK versions 22 and older can be used.
You can alternatively use the latest version of the Android NDK which is greater than 22. However, this requires a hack to prevent the unable to find library -lgcc error.



Build flutter bindings
Navigate to rust directory, and run the following commands
cargo build
make all
